Understanding Wood Burning Stoves
Wood burning stoves are developed to burn wood fuel in an efficient manner. They come in different styles, sizes, and performances, commonly classified into 2 categories: traditional and modern stoves.
Types of Wood Burning Stoves1. Traditional Wood Stoves
These stoves have a timeless design and are frequently constructed from cast iron or steel.
Pros: Timeless visual appeals, durability.Cons: Generally less efficient than modern stoves.2. Modern Wood Stoves
These make use of advanced innovations for combustion efficiency and lower emissions. They frequently consist of functions like glass doors and streamlined designs.
Pros: Higher efficiency, modern aesthetic appeals.Cons: May be more costly.3. Insert Stoves
These are created to suit existing fireplaces, transforming them into efficient heating sources.
Pros: Space-efficient, reduces changes to home.Cons: Limited style alternatives.4. Freestanding Stoves
These can be placed throughout your home, supplied there is sufficient clearance and ventilation.
Pros: Flexible installation, visual range.Cons: Requires more space.Fuel Sources for Wood Burning Stoves

Factors to consider When Buying a Wood Burning Stove Online
When considering purchasing a wood burning range online, there are numerous elements to contemplate:
1. Room Size and Heat Output
Stoves come in numerous heats up outputs measured in BTUs. It's essential to compute your room size and select a stove that will effectively warm the area.
2. Efficiency Ratings
Search for stoves with high efficiency ratings. Modern EPA-certified stoves take in less wood and produce fewer emissions.
3. Setup Requirements
Think about the requirements for venting and clearance. Some models may need a specific chimney system.
4. Regulations and Codes
Examine regional building regulations and policies concerning wood burning devices to ensure compliance.
5. Warranty and Service
Investigate the service warranty offered by the maker and client assistance choices.
6. Customer Reviews
Checking out client evaluations can offer insights into efficiency and warranty service.

A1: Regular cleaning of the range and chimney is important to prevent creosote buildup. Annual inspections by professionals are recommended.
Q2: Can I use my wood burning range to cook?
A2: Yes, numerous wood burning stoves are created for cooking, especially traditional designs.
Q3: Is it safe to leave a wood burning range ignored?
A3: It is usually not recommended to leave a wood range unattended while it is lit. Always follow security standards.
Q4: What type of wood is best for burning?
A4: Seasoned wood such as oak, hickory, and maple is ideal due to its high energy material and low emissions.
Q5: How do I make sure great air quality while using a wood burning stove?
A5: Use skilled wood, preserve proper ventilation, and make sure the range is effectively set up to reduce smoke and hazardous emissions.
